In connection to our last episode about standardized tests (and should teachers hate it,) we have another episode about testing, but this time we dive into the money behind standardized tests, and why you should pay attention to your federal and local politics. You might have seen the figure of 13.4 billion dollars floating around the internet, when talking about the cost of standardized testing in Texas. I did, and that's why I reached out to the guy who created the figure, Michael Messer, and picked his brain about where this number comes from, and why we should all care about it.
